The Uganda healthcare information software market is experiencing steady growth driven by increasing adoption of technology in healthcare facilities, government initiatives to improve healthcare infrastructure, and a growing demand for efficient healthcare management systems. Key players in the market offer a range of software solutions including electronic health records (EHR), hospital information systems (HIS), telemedicine platforms, and healthcare analytics tools. Cloud-based solutions are gaining popularity due to their scalability and cost-effectiveness. However, challenges such as limited IT infrastructure, data security concerns, and lack of skilled professionals hinder market growth. Overall, the market presents opportunities for software providers to innovate and tailor solutions to meet the specific needs of healthcare providers in Uganda.

In the Uganda Healthcare Information Software Market, some of the key challenges include limited access to technology and internet connectivity in remote areas, lack of standardized data collection and reporting practices across healthcare facilities, insufficient investment in training healthcare professionals on how to effectively use healthcare information software, and concerns around data privacy and security. Additionally, the market also faces challenges related to the affordability and sustainability of healthcare information software solutions for both public and private healthcare providers. Overcoming these challenges will require investment in infrastructure, capacity building, regulatory frameworks, and public-private partnerships to ensure the successful implementation and adoption of healthcare information software across the country`s healthcare system.
